Nutrition and Mental Health
While emotional healing is crucial, physical well-being should not be overlooked. Your health and nutrition play a significant role in shaping your mental space. Eating a balanced diet rich in vitamins and minerals can bolster emotional resilience. Foods rich in omega-3 fatty acids, like salmon and walnuts, have been shown to enhance mood, while leafy greens can improve cognitive function. Furthermore, staying hydrated and engaging in regular exercise can help reduce feelings of anxiety and depression during the healing process.
Healing Through Fitness
For many, regular exercise serves as an outlet for distress and grief. Activities such as yoga, walking, or even dance can provide a physical release of emotions and foster a sense of community. Local classes often bring together individuals who are on their healing journeys, offering a sense of support through shared movement. Incorporating various forms of physical activity into your routine can elevate mood and contribute to better overall health, making it easier to cope with emotional setbacks.
